Mavatar CEO Johan Juhlin compares the situation to environmental challenges and oil industry resistance. He notes established players often oppose disruptive technologies. His company's AI model analyzes complex disease relationships through genetic data visualization.

Screen graphics resemble colorful snowflakes with red and blue lines branching from central gray circles. These visualizations actually represent rare butterfly disease and its genetic connections to psoriasis, skin cancer, and leprosy. Each line signals relationships and potential insights extracted from research study data volumes.

Johan Juhlin describes this as the new generation of research tools. Scientists traditionally build upon existing knowledge, but their model scans all available data for connections without literature dependence. If butterfly disease shares characteristics with psoriasis, similar treatment approaches might prove effective.
